Kringvarp Føroya’s Breddin programme is examining how the ongoing war in Iran is affecting ordinary people’s finances and what can be done in the Faroe Islands to limit the consequences.
Oil prices have risen sharply since the war began earlier this year. The conflict, which US President Donald Trump said would last four to five weeks, has continued for more than six months.
The Strait of Hormuz has been more or less closed since the United States and Israel attacked Iran at the end of February. The Bab al-Mandeb Strait is now also closed, and there is no indication that the war will end soon.
Breddin addresses the economic impact on ordinary people and possible measures in the Faroe Islands. The programme airs at 10am.
